A registered agent is an assigned individual or organization entity accountable for receiving important legal and certifications in support of a business or company. This duty is an essential part of a business's lawful and compliance framework, making sure that notices such as service of process, government document, and compliance filings are appropriately received and dealt with in a timely way. The registered agent acts as the factor of get in touch with between the business and the state, providing a reputable address where lawful records can be offered throughout common service hours. additional details need that an organization maintain a registered agent as component of its development and recurring compliance responsibilities. Picking the best registered agent can considerably impact a firm's capacity to react quickly to legal notifications and stay clear of fines or default judgments. The agent's address have to be a physical place within the state of formation or procedure, not a P.O. box, which emphasizes the importance of a relied on, obtainable visibility within the jurisdiction. Some companies opt to offer as their very own registered agent, while others work with professional registered agent solutions to make sure compliance and discretion. Specialist registered agents often supply fringe benefits such as paper forwarding, compliance informs, and safe handling of delicate information, making them a popular selection for busy entrepreneurs and corporations. In general, a registered agent plays an important function in keeping a company's legal standing and helping with smooth interaction with government companies and legal entities.
